Business Class from Minneapolis to San José
San José is the hub for one of the most efficient country-hopping trips in Latin America — from Juan Santamaría International, you can be soaking in La Fortuna's hot springs near Arenal Volcano, hiking the Monteverde cloud forest, or catching waves on the Nicoya Peninsula within two hours of landing. It's also become a serious draw for corporate travelers, thanks to Costa Rica's medical tourism industry, coffee and agriculture trade with the Midwest, and a growing tech and outsourcing sector that keeps consultants and executives moving between Minneapolis and San José year-round.

Airlines & Cabin Experience
There's no nonstop widebody service on this route, so Minneapolis to San José business class routes through a connecting hub, and your airline choice really comes down to which layover fits your schedule and which cabin you prefer. Delta runs its Delta One Suite product through Atlanta — a proper suite with a closing door, Tumi amenity kits, and the most private setup of the three carriers, in a 1-2-1 configuration that guarantees aisle access from every seat. American routes through Miami or Dallas with its Flagship Business suite, also 1-2-1 with a lie-flat seat, Casper bedding, and access to the Flagship Lounge if your connection runs through a hub that has one. LATAM, which dominates South American routes, typically connects through Lima or Bogotá with a 2-2-2 lie-flat cabin — a solid product, though the middle seats in that configuration mean couples traveling together should book the center pair rather than window/aisle.

Pricing & Best Time to Fly
Fares on this route swing widely depending on how far out you book and which season you're targeting. We're seeing $1,700 to $5,200 round-trip through our consolidator contracts, and the gap between those numbers is almost entirely about timing. January through March lines up with Costa Rica's dry season and the busiest tourist demand, so fares run higher unless you book at least six to eight weeks ahead. June and July catch the U.S. summer break and a brief dry spell in the Central Valley, while November and December are strong for both leisure travelers escaping winter and business travelers closing out the year — book early for those months too, since Delta and American allocate a limited number of premium award and discount seats before prices jump.

Because this is a medium-haul itinerary at roughly eight hours total travel time including the connection, the actual comfort difference between carriers matters less here than on a true long-haul flight to Asia or Europe — but a lie-flat seat still makes a real difference on the longer of the two segments, particularly if you're connecting through Atlanta or Dallas where layovers can stretch past ninety minutes. Overnight westbound-style routing (redeye out of Minneapolis) is less common on this itinerary than daytime departures, so plan for a full day of travel rather than sleeping through it. If you have status with any of the three carriers, factor in lounge access during your connection — American's Flagship Lounges in Dallas and Miami are a noticeable upgrade over the standard Admirals Club, and Delta's Sky Club in Atlanta gets crowded but has solid food options for a midday layover.
